Quick Answer

University of California, Berkeley has a 11.4% acceptance rate with a middle 50% SAT range of 1330-1530 and average GPA of 3.91. Top public university for engineering, CS, and the social sciences. Founded 1868 in Berkeley, CA.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is UC Berkeley's acceptance rate?

University of California, Berkeley's acceptance rate is approximately 11.4% based on the most recent Common Data Set. This rate can vary by year and by application round (ED, EA, RD).

What SAT score do I need for UC Berkeley?

The middle 50% SAT range for UC Berkeley is 1330-1530. Scoring above 1530 does not guarantee admission, and scoring below 1330 does not mean rejection — holistic review considers the full application.

What GPA do I need to get into UC Berkeley?

The average unweighted GPA of admitted students at UC Berkeley is approximately 3.91. Course rigor (AP/IB/dual enrollment) matters as much as the GPA number itself.

Is UC Berkeley test-optional?

UC Berkeley is test-blind — they do not consider test scores. Test policies can change each admissions cycle.

How many students attend UC Berkeley?

University of California, Berkeley has approximately 32,830 undergraduate students. As a public university, it offers a large campus community with diverse academic programs.
